Yu. A. Kuritsyn is a scholar working on Spectroscopy, Electrical and Electronic Engineering and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Yu. A. Kuritsyn has authored 45 papers receiving a total of 655 ind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Spectroscopy, 31 papers in Electrical and Electronic Engineering and 14 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Yu. A. Kuritsyn’s work include Spectroscopy and Laser Applications (41 papers), Electric Discharge Pumped Lasers (30 papers) and Atmospheric and Environmental Gas Dynamics (7 papers). Yu. A. Kuritsyn is often cited by papers focused on Spectroscopy and Laser Applications (41 papers), Electric Discharge Pumped Lasers (30 papers) and Atmospheric and Environmental Gas Dynamics (7 papers). Yu. A. Kuritsyn collaborates with scholars based in Russia, Germany and United States. Yu. A. Kuritsyn's co-authors include Mikhail A. Bolshov, Yu.V. Romanovskii, K. Niemax, V R Mironenko, Alexander Zybin, Igor Pak, A. G. Maki, V.M. Krivtsun, Evgeny L. Gurevich and A. Zybin and has published in prestigious journals such as Sensors, AIAA Journal and Molecular Physics.
